Article 3 The people's governments at all levels in Shantou shall create a fair investment environment for sole proprietorship enterprises. The property and lawful rights and interests of a sole proprietorship enterprise and its investors are protected by law. Article 4 The relevant administrative and judicial organs of Shantou City shall, according to their respective functions and duties, ensure the implementation of these Regulations. The Federation of Industry and Commerce and the Association of Private Enterprises shall assist in the implementation of these Regulations. Article 5 An investor applying for the establishment of a sole proprietorship enterprise shall have the capacity for civil rights and full capacity for civil conduct.
Individuals who are prohibited from engaging in profit-making activities by laws and regulations may not apply for the establishment of a sole proprietorship enterprise. Article 6 An investor may set up a sole proprietorship enterprise in cash, in kind, land use right, industrial property right, non-patented technology or other property rights. The above-mentioned capital contribution shall be the legal property and property right of the investor. Article 7 Investors of a sole proprietorship enterprise shall enjoy the ownership of the enterprise property according to law and exercise the rights of possession, use, profit and disposal. Its related rights can be transferred and inherited.
No organization or individual may occupy, plunder, destroy, extort or otherwise infringe upon the lawful property of a sole proprietorship enterprise. Article 8 A sole proprietorship enterprise may obtain the land use right according to law. The land use right and the legal buildings and structures on the ground obtained by a sole proprietorship enterprise by way of transferee may be transferred, subscribed, transferred and used as mortgage of creditor's rights according to law within the land use period stipulated in the transferee contract.
It is forbidden for any unit or individual to occupy or destroy the legitimate business premises of a sole proprietorship enterprise.
If the legal business premises of a sole proprietorship enterprise need to be demolished due to construction, compensation and resettlement shall be given according to law. Article 9 A sole proprietorship enterprise shall enjoy the right to operate independently according to law. Except for industries, commodities and projects that must be examined and approved by the relevant municipal competent departments according to laws and regulations, investors may directly apply to the enterprise registration authority for registration, and no organization or individual may illegally interfere. Article 10 Wholly-owned enterprises are encouraged to participate in the production and operation of state-owned and collective enterprises in competitive industries. Wholly-owned enterprises contracting, leasing, merging and purchasing state-owned and collective small and medium-sized enterprises shall enjoy preferential treatment according to relevant regulations. Article 11 A productive sole proprietorship enterprise that meets the prescribed conditions has the right to import and export its products and has the right to import equipment, spare parts and raw materials needed for its production within the approved scope. Article 12 A sole proprietorship enterprise shall enjoy the pricing power according to law. Except for the important commodities and services stipulated by laws and regulations and listed in the government pricing catalogue, a sole proprietorship enterprise can make its own pricing and obtain legitimate profits in its production, operation and service provision. If it belongs to the government-guided price, it can be priced within the prescribed range. Article 13 A sole proprietorship enterprise shall enjoy the exclusive right to its name (trade name), registered trademark and patent according to law. No unit or individual may infringe upon it. Article 14 A sole proprietorship enterprise may open RMB and foreign currency accounts in banks according to its business needs and participate in foreign exchange transactions in accordance with relevant state regulations. A sole proprietorship enterprise has the right to apply for a loan. Commercial financial institutions shall provide credit and other financial services to sole proprietorship enterprises according to law. Article 15 An investor of a sole proprietorship enterprise may, as a partner or one of the shareholders, set up a partnership enterprise or company according to law due to business needs. Article 16 A sole proprietorship enterprise shall enjoy the right of employment and internal management according to law. A sole proprietorship enterprise has the right to decide its employment form, employment quantity, employment period and salary amount according to law. Article 17 The personnel and labor departments at or above the district level shall be responsible for the introduction and employment of all kinds of professional and management talents that meet the deployment conditions in a sole proprietorship enterprise according to their respective management authority. A sole proprietorship enterprise may apply for Shantou household registration for qualified employees in accordance with the relevant provisions of Shantou household registration management. Eighteenth employees of a sole proprietorship enterprise are responsible for the examination of professional and technical qualifications and qualification examination materials, and the institutions designated by the provincial and municipal personnel title reform departments are responsible for the examination. Those who meet the requirements after examination shall be submitted to the personnel title reform department at or above the district level for examination or go through the registration formalities according to the prescribed procedures. Those who pass the re-examination shall be awarded professional and technical qualification certificates. The appointment of relevant professional and technical positions shall be decided by the sole proprietorship enterprise. Article 19 If a sole proprietorship enterprise sends its employees abroad (territory) or invites foreign customers to enter (territory) due to business needs, it shall apply to the visa authority for entry and exit visas after being signed by the Municipal Federation of Industry and Commerce or the private enterprise association.
